Shadow Hawk, Renton, WA Guía Local

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Shadow Hawk?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Shadow Hawk | $1,567 | $1,210 | $2,008 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Shadow Hawk | $1,891 | $1,320 | $2,540 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Shadow Hawk | $2,312 | $1,541 | $3,937 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Shadow Hawk | $2,764 | $2,374 | $3,655 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Shadow Hawk | $2,997 | $2,997 | $2,997 |
